UGANDA. COURT UPHOLDS DEATH SENTENCE FOR MURDER OF INFANT

a panel of three judges of the Court of Appeal unanimously ruled that the trial judge, Lugadya Atwooki, who presided over the High Court sitting in Mbale, Uganda, on November 11, 2002, had rightly sentenced Zubairi Waira, in his sixties, to death.

“We have no justification to fault the trial judge’s findings. In the result, this appeal lacks merit and it is hereby dismissed forthwith. We uphold the conviction and confirm the sentence of death,” the panel ruled. It was alleged that on June 11, 1999, Waira killed an infant boy in Pallisa whom his wife, Annet Magosi, had mothered with a previous husband.
